OBERLIN CITY COUNCIL MEETING
AGENDA: December 4, 2017
Meeting Place:
Council Chambers, 85 S. Main Street
Dates: 1st & 3rd Mondays

PEARSON BURGESS SLOCUM RIMBERT SOUCY BROADWELL SINGLETON


Ronnie Rimbert: President of Council
Linda Slocum: Vice-President of Council
Belinda Anderson: Clerk of Council
Jon Clark: Law Director
Salvatore Talarico: Finance Director
Rob Hillard: City Manager 
 
 REGULAR CITY COUNCIL MEETING – 7:00 P.M. – COUNCIL CHAMBERS
 
             
1.   COUNCIL BUSINESS
 
a.   Call Regular City Council Meeting to Order and Roll Call – 7:00 p.m.
 
b.   Approval of Minutes – Regular City Council Meeting – November 20, 2017  Click to View
 
c.   Appointment to City Boards and Commissions  Click to View
 
d.   OMLPS recommendation and request for City Council approval for the disposition of a 2002 International Aerial Lift Truck and a 2004 Dodge Dakota. Click to View
 
e.   Discuss and consider a Motion to authorize the City Manager to enter into a legal services agreement with Walter Haverfield to initiate a challenge to H.B. 49 as to the Centralized Administration and Collection of the Municipal Net Profit Tax provisions of Ohio Revised Code Chapter 718 jointly with other municipalities and the Regional Income Tax Agency.

 
Click to View
 
2.   ANY CONCERNS THAT ARE NOT ON THE AGENDA MAY BE BROUGHT TO THE ATTENTION OF COUNCIL AT THIS TIME

(Members of the public and Council members may address the City Council for a maximum of three minutes each.)
 
3.   OLD BUSINESS
 
4.   NEW BUSINESS
 
A.   Ordinance No. 17-57 AC CMS: An Ordinance Authorizing the City Manager to Enter into a Contract with Siemens Industry, Inc. for Richland, Mississippi, for the purchase of 69 kV Breakers for the Switch Station 69 kV Breaker Project for the Oberlin Municipal Light and Power System and Declaring an Emergency.
(1st)(E)
Click to View
 
B.   Ordinance No. 17-58 AC CMS:  An Ordinance to Appropriate Monies for Municipal Purposes for the Fiscal Year 2018 and Declaring an Emergency.
(1st)(E)
Click to View
 
C.   Ordinance No. 17-59 AC CMS:  An Ordinance Amending Chapter 184 of the Codified Ordinances of the City of Oberlin which Provides for a Municipal Income Tax and Declaring an Emergency
(1st)(E)
Click to View
